[QUOTE="urbangiraffe, post: 1506228, member: 290357"] I've been on Roche's Accu-Chek Insight pump for a couple of years, having upgraded from the Spirit Combo. I can't wait to come off it when the warranty expires. The main issue for me is that the user interface is soooo slow on the handset - there are so many screens and it takes an age to load each one - that frequently it times out mid process (whilst I have been distracted onto something else), and I forget that my bolus hasn't actually been delivered. The fact that this happens and that there is no reminder - "you entered carbs, did you want to deliver a bolus?" makes the pump, in my eyes, not fit for purpose. Due to this issue, I now frequently miss boluses and my long-term control has deteriorated massively. I have spoken with my DSN and the pump manufacturer regularly about this over the years I have been on it, the pump has been replaced, but no solution can be found. And so I have been stuck on it until the warranty runs out and the NHS Trust will agree to move me to a different pump. The handset also has regular electronic errors, and again it has been replaced but no solution found. So frustrating. [/QUOTE]
